If angle vsr = 8x+18, find the value of x so that us is perpendicular to vs

Given that vsr=8x+18, the value of x that that will make r is perpendicular to vs can be obtained as follows;
let:
vsr=8x+18=90
solving for x we get:
8x+18=90
8x=90-18
8x=72
x=72/8
x=9
The answer is x=9
